Efficient cytometry analysis with FlowSOM in Python boosts interoperability with other single-cell tools

AbstractMotivationWe describe a new Python implementation of FlowSOM, a clustering method for cytometry data.ResultsThis implementation is faster than the original version in R, better adapted to work with single-cell omics data including integration with current single-cell data structures and includes all the original visualizations, such as the star...

VirusPredictor: XGBoost-based software to predict virus-related sequences in human data

AbstractMotivationDiscovering disease causative pathogens, particularly viruses without reference genomes, poses a technical challenge as they are often unidentifiable through sequence alignment. Machine learning prediction of patient high-throughput sequences unmappable to human and pathogen genomes may reveal sequences originating from uncharacterized...
